Sundews are a type of carnivorous plant that uses a sticky nectar to trap prey. Depending on the species, these plants grow in the wet, acidic soil found in bogs, fens, swamps, and sandy streambanks, or in areas with lots of sphagnum moss, or in sandy soil that is nutrient-poor but dry for large portions of the year. In fact, sundews can be found on every continent except Antarctica!
